Can anyone help? I just took my flight physical and only one of my eyes has an astigmatism of 1.25, 0.25 above the allowable range. My eyesight is 20/20 and 20/25 and my better eye is 1.00 which are all within range. I'm a S2S/civilian and I read that the army will allow waivers for 0.75 out of range. Is this true for a S2S or only AD? What are my options?

I wear my contacts most days. You just have to have prescription glasses in your flight bag with you on the helicopter. I keep a pair in my bag, and wear them if I forget my contacts or something.
